package java.lang.constant;

import java.lang.invoke.MethodHandles;

import sun.invoke.util.Wrapper;

import static java.util.Objects.requireNonNull;

A nominal descriptor for the class constant corresponding to a primitive type (e.g., int.class).
/** * A <a href="package-summary.html#nominal">nominal descriptor</a> for the class * constant corresponding to a primitive type (e.g., {@code int.class}). */
final class PrimitiveClassDescImpl extends DynamicConstantDesc<Class<?>> implements ClassDesc { private final String descriptor;
Creates a ClassDesc given a descriptor string for a primitive type.
Params:
  • descriptor – the descriptor string, which must be a one-character string corresponding to one of the nine base types
Throws:
@jvms4.3 Descriptors
/** * Creates a {@linkplain ClassDesc} given a descriptor string for a primitive * type. * * @param descriptor the descriptor string, which must be a one-character * string corresponding to one of the nine base types * @throws IllegalArgumentException if the descriptor string does not * describe a valid primitive type * @jvms 4.3 Descriptors */
PrimitiveClassDescImpl(String descriptor) { super(ConstantDescs.BSM_PRIMITIVE_CLASS, requireNonNull(descriptor), ConstantDescs.CD_Class); if (descriptor.length() != 1 || "VIJCSBFDZ".indexOf(descriptor.charAt(0)) < 0) throw new IllegalArgumentException(String.format("not a valid primitive type descriptor: %s", descriptor)); this.descriptor = descriptor; } @Override public String descriptorString() { return descriptor; } @Override public Class<?> resolveConstantDesc(MethodHandles.Lookup lookup) { return Wrapper.forBasicType(descriptorString().charAt(0)).primitiveType(); } @Override public String toString() { return String.format("PrimitiveClassDesc[%s]", displayName()); } }
